Comprehensive Service Offerings
To ensure our data is beyond reproach, we employ rigorous methodologies that account for the unique physics of glass thermometry.
Emergent Stem Correction: If a total immersion thermometer is used incorrectly with only the bulb submerged, it will result in a significant "Emergent Stem" error. Our technicians monitor the ambient temperature of the emergent column during calibration to apply the necessary corrections.
Ice Point Verification (0°): Over years of use, the glass bulb can undergo "Zero-Shift" as the glass material relaxes. By identifying this shift, we provide you with a precise correction factor.
Column Reunion: We utilize specialized cooling and heating techniques to reunite separated liquid columns, a frequent issue encountered when thermometers are handled in busy workshops or transported through the high-vibration environment of long-haul desert logistics.

Industry Segments We Serve in Saudi Arabia
Petrochemicals and Oil Refining (Jubail & Yanbu)
In the massive petrochemical complexes of Jubail and Yanbu, precision is a matter of both safety and yield. High-precision ASTM glass thermometers are mandatory for determining the boiling points, flash points, and viscosity of chemical intermediates and fuels. Because glass is resistant to aggressive chemical vapors and requires no electrical power, it remains the "Gold Standard" for benchtop QC analysis where electronic sensors might be corroded or present a spark risk in hazardous zones. Our calibration ensures these manual safety checks are accurate to within a fraction of a degree, preventing fire hazards and ensuring international purity standards.
Pharmaceutical and Vaccine Cold Chain (Riyadh & Sudair)
As Saudi Arabia builds its domestic pharmaceutical capacity, glass thermometers serve as primary check-standards for stability chambers and ultra-low temperature freezers. In high-compliance labs, the LIG thermometer is used to verify the accuracy of automated data loggers. Because they have no electronic drift and are immune to power outages, they provide a failsafe reference for monitoring sensitive vaccines. Our NABL-certified calibration provides the documented proof of accuracy required for SFDA and WHO-GMP inspections.

Frequently Asked Questions (FAQs)
Q: Why does my glass thermometer read differently than the digital probe in my Jubail plant?
A: This is often due to the Response Time and Immersion Depth. Glass thermometers have a higher thermal mass and take longer to reach equilibrium than electronic probes. Furthermore, if the thermometer is not immersed to its correct marked line (for partial immersion types), it will give an incorrect reading. Our calibration process identifies these potential errors and provides a guide on "Best Measurement Practices."
Q: Can Vega calibrate the "Non-Mercury" spirit thermometers we use for our green-certified plant in NEOM?
A: Yes. We specialize in calibrating spirit-filled and organic-liquid-filled thermometers. These are safer but require careful handling, as the liquid can sometimes "cling" to the glass, causing drainage errors. Our technicians account for this "drainage time" during our NABL calibration process to ensure absolute accuracy for your eco-friendly project.
Q: What is the benefit of a Glass Thermometer over an RTD for our chemical godown?
A: The primary benefit is Inherent Stability and Safety. Unlike RTDs, glass thermometers are immune to battery failure, circuit corrosion, and electromagnetic noise. In hazardous petrochemical storage, they provide a reliable, spark-free reference that requires no electrical power, ensuring safety standards are met even during power outages.
Q: How often should the precision ASTM thermometers in our Saudi facility be calibrated?
A: For thermometers used in high-precision QC tests, we recommend an annual (12-month) cycle. However, for thermometers used daily in high-temperature processes or harsh coastal environments, a 6-month check is technically sound to monitor for glass fatigue and bulb contraction caused by the Kingdom’s extreme seasonal heat.
